At Dulles Airport, Phoenix Sky Harbor airport, and airports all across the nation and overseas, they have replaced the traditional monitors that you used to see in most airports with a flight information display system (FIDS) - the presentation tier (interface) is created dynamically by a Flash application that receives all the data via XML streams from a Windows 2003 (.Net) server.
